Output ef7b3964253beb6fadd01b9d02aa755ae90e42c453f4eeebdde3d4233d67b545:0

value
16578673
script pubkey
OP_0 OP_PUSHBYTES_20 18a4417b9839d99b0c1600ce4f97cc13c3e8e127
address
bc1qrzjyz7uc88vekrqkqr8yl97vz0p73cf8exch5d
transaction
ef7b3964253beb6fadd01b9d02aa755ae90e42c453f4eeebdde3d4233d67b545
confirmations
52
spent
false